示例#1
0
		public void ToString ()
		{
			var el = new XStreamingElement ("foo",
				new XAttribute ("bar", "baz"),
				"text");
			Assert.AreEqual ("<foo bar=\"baz\">text</foo>", el.ToString ());
		}
示例#2
0
		public void ToStringAttributeAfterText ()
		{
			var el = new XStreamingElement ("foo",
				"text",
				new XAttribute ("bar", "baz"));
			el.ToString ();
		}
示例#3
0
 public void XNameConstructor()
 {
     XStreamingElement streamElement = new XStreamingElement("contact");
     Assert.Equal("<contact />", streamElement.ToString());
 }
示例#4
0
 public void XNameAndNullObjectConstructor()
 {
     XStreamingElement streamElement = new XStreamingElement("contact", null);
     Assert.Equal("<contact />", streamElement.ToString());
 }
示例#5
0
 public void AddWithNull()
 {
     XStreamingElement streamElement = new XStreamingElement("contact");
     streamElement.Add(null);
     Assert.Equal("<contact />", streamElement.ToString());
 }
示例#6
0
 public void XMLPropertyGet()
 {
     XElement contact = new XElement("contact", new XElement("phone", "925-555-0134"));
     XStreamingElement streamElement = new XStreamingElement("contact", contact.Element("phone"));
     Assert.Equal(contact.ToString(SaveOptions.None), streamElement.ToString(SaveOptions.None));
 }
示例#7
0
 //[Variation(Priority = 0, Desc = "Constructor - XStreamingElement(XName)")]
 public void XNameConstructor()
 {
     XStreamingElement streamElement = new XStreamingElement("contact");
     if (!streamElement.ToString().Equals("<contact />"))
         throw new TestFailedException("");
 }
示例#8
0
 //[Variation(Priority = 1, Desc = "Add(null)")]
 public void AddWithNull()
 {
     XStreamingElement streamElement = new XStreamingElement("contact");
     streamElement.Add(null);
     if (!streamElement.ToString().Equals("<contact />"))
         throw new TestFailedException("");
 }
示例#9
0
 //[Variation(Priority = 0, Desc = "XML Property")]
 public void XMLPropertyGet()
 {
     XElement contact = new XElement("contact", new XElement("phone", "925-555-0134"));
     XStreamingElement streamElement = new XStreamingElement("contact", contact.Element("phone"));
     if (!streamElement.ToString(SaveOptions.None).Equals(contact.ToString(SaveOptions.None)))
         throw new TestFailedException("");
 }